What causes the difference in how far different DNA fragments move through an agarose gel?

The difference in how far DNA fragments move through an agarose gel is primarily influenced by their size. Smaller DNA fragments navigate through the porous matrix of the gel more easily than larger ones, allowing them to travel further in a given time. Additionally, the gel concentration can affect the mobility of the fragments; higher concentrations create smaller pores that hinder the movement of larger DNA. Overall, this size-dependent mobility is used in techniques like gel electrophoresis to separate DNA fragments for analysis.

How do you interpret the results of a gel electrophoresis?

The results of a gel electrophoresis show the sizes of DNA fragments or proteins based on how far they move through a gel under an electric field. Smaller fragments move faster and farther than larger ones. Scientists analyze the pattern of bands on the gel to determine the sizes and quantities of the fragments present in the sample.
